Government lists 135 Kashmir based Journalists as ‘accredited’

Srinagar: The Department of Information and Public Relations (DIPR) has uploaded the list of Accredited Media-persons from both Kashmir and Jammu divisions on its official website.

To remove the discrepancies, if any, in the Accredited Media list, the DIPR has urged the Journalists and the News Media Organizations to bring the same into the notice of the Department through Shabir Ahmad, Media Coordinator on Cell No: 9419007581 so that the matter is placed before the News Media Accreditation Committee in its next meeting for review and appropriate action, an official spoeksperson said on late Wednesday evening.

As no meeting of the Accreditation Committee was convened last year, the DIPR has renewed the Accreditation Cards of journalists issued in 2015-16 following the recommendations of the Press Accreditation Committee.

The Government has recently notified the New Accreditation Policy replacing the outdated Accreditation Policy of 1997.

The Government has also extended the term of the Accreditation Committee which was constituted last year.

There are presently 265 accredited media-persons in Jammu and Kashmir including 135 in Kashmir division and 130 in Jammu division.

Pertinently, the Accreditation not only facilitates the access of the journalists to various important government functions and events, but also entitles them to various benefits including government accommodation, concessional medical treatment in various premiere hospitals, 50% rebate in rail fare in all classes etc.
